Oats with nuts and lemon
Ingredients
- 200 ml coconut milk
- 40 gram steel cut oats
- 4 dates stones removed
- 40 gram unsalted roasted nuts roughly chopped
- 1 lemon
- 1 tbsp coconut flakes
Instructions
- Place the coconut milk in a saucepan and mix with the oats. Bring this to the boil and leave to boil for about 5 minutes. (or longer if you prefer them softer)
- As soon as your oats are cooked to your liking, place in a bowl and sprinkle with the chopped dates, the nuts and the coconut flakes
- Grate some of the lemonzest over the bowl and squeeze a bit of lemon juice over the dish. Eat straight away.
